What a Session Typically Looks Like

  • Sessions run live, 2–3 hours each.

  • 100% virtual — synchronous, live sessions your team joins from the comfort of the center or home. No in-person option.

  • Scheduled at times that work for your team — no fixed public calendar to work around.

  • Certificates delivered to every attendee within 48 hours of their session.
